Any information that can be used to identify a minor petitioning a circuit court for a judicial waiver, as provided in s. 390.01114, of the notice requirements under the Parental Notice of Abortion Act is:
(1) Confidential and exempt from s. 24(a), Art. I of the State Constitution if held by a circuit court or an appellate court.
(2) Confidential and exempt from s. 119.07(1) and s. 24(a), Art. I of the State Constitution if held by the office of criminal conflict and civil regional counsel or the Justice Administrative Commission.
